MYSQL安裝教程

第一步:下載MYSQL安裝包。html

MYSQL官方網站:https://dev.mysql.com/downloads/installer/mysql

百度雲連接:sql

連接:https://pan.baidu.com/s/1cFYUqQQS85Fn5JxTOm4xJA
提取碼:duuh數據庫

第二步:雙擊安裝包,進行安裝。ide

  1.選擇NEXT。工具

 

  2.繼續選擇NEXT。網站

  3.須要注意的是當Check Requirements時,若是你有未安裝的插件,以下圖中的Connector/ODBC...時,須要選擇Excute進行下載安裝。ui

 

  4.待插件所有安裝成功後,以下圖所示,再次選擇NEXT。this

 

   5.進入Apply Updates時,選擇Excute ,以後再次點擊Next->Finish。url

 

   6.緊接着會彈出一個界面,咱們須要選擇添加mysql服務。

 

  7.選擇mysql server服務,加入。並點擊NEXT。

 

  8.一樣咱們須要點擊Excute下載安裝,完成後以下圖所示,並點擊NEXT->FINISH。

 

  8.下面到了最爲關鍵的步驟 ,如今、立刻、馬上,拿一支筆、拿一個筆記本(不是隨便一張紙)!!!由於一下東西不記好,之後你會像吃shit同樣煩!

 

  9.如圖所示Port(端口號)後邊有黃色驚歎號,說明當前默認的端口號被佔用,須要更換端口號。

 

  10.如圖所示,我將端口更換爲3303,切記!更換後的端口號必定要牢記,最好整理到經常使用的筆記本上。記錄好以後,單機NEXT,NEXT。

 

   11.接下來一樣至關重要,爲你的root用戶設置密碼,設置密碼時必定要先把要設置的密碼記錄下來,再輸入。

    密碼設置成功後,能夠選擇添加用戶,也能夠等待安裝成功後再添加。

 

  12.能夠修改你的服務名,通常默認便可。選擇NEXT。

 

 

  13.Excute->NEXT->Finish->NEXT->Finish。

到此mysql數據庫安裝完畢,可是目前還不能正常使用。

 

第三步,配置環境變量。

  1.右鍵本機(個人電腦、這臺電腦、此電腦),選擇屬性。左側找到高級系統設置,單擊;

  2.選擇高級->環境變量->在系統變量裏找到Path->選中->雙擊(點擊編輯)->右側單擊瀏覽,找到mysql的安裝目錄(注:路徑到bin目錄)。

  3.以後一路肯定。。。

OK,環境變量配置完畢!可是你覺得就這樣完了嗎!?too young,too simple!

 

第四步,也就是最後一步!添加配置文件。

  1.找到你的mysql安裝目錄,默認如圖所示。

 

  2.以下圖所示,若是你的安裝目錄下有my.ini文件,可省略此步驟,直接去數據庫的世界玩耍吧!若是沒有,乖乖跟着我一塊兒添加配置文件吧!

  3.新建文本文檔,複製以下代碼:

複製代碼
1 [mysqld]
 2 # 設置3306端口
 3 port=3306
 4 # 設置mysql的安裝目錄
 5 basedir=C:\Program Files\MySQL
 6 # 設置mysql數據庫的數據的存放目錄
 7 datadir=C:\Program Files\MySQL\Data
 8 # 容許最大鏈接數
 9 max_connections=200
10 # 容許鏈接失敗的次數。
11 max_connect_errors=10
12 # 服務端使用的字符集默認爲UTF8
13 character-set-server=utf8
14 # 建立新表時將使用的默認存儲引擎
15 default-storage-engine=INNODB
16 # 默認使用「mysql_native_password」插件認證
17 #mysql_native_password
18 default_authentication_plugin=mysql_native_password
19 [mysql]
20 # 設置mysql客戶端默認字符集
21 default-character-set=utf8
22 [client]
23 # 設置mysql客戶端鏈接服務端時默認使用的端口
24 port=3306
25 default-character-set=utf8
複製代碼

 

 

  4.點擊保存後,將文件名和後綴名改成 my.ini 。

  5.以管理員身份運行命令提示符(即:cmd),進入mysql安裝目錄,輸入mysqld --initialize --console,9P0gYk-?0,kT就是初始密碼,必定要記錄。

 

   6.繼續在命令行中輸入mysqld --install,若是出現 Service successfully installed.即爲成功! 

  若是出現如下內容,須要刪除原有服務。

   刪除原有服務須要在命令行中輸入:sc delete mysql。

  以後再次輸入:mysqld --install。

 

  7.mysql服務安裝成功後,須要啓動服務。在命令行中輸入:net start mysql 。

到此,mysql數據庫所有安裝、配置完畢,能夠正常使用了!

  登陸mysql,在命令行中輸入:mysql -uroot -p 回車,輸入root密碼。也可使用用戶登陸,將root改成你本身的用戶名便可。

  注! -p後邊能夠直接跟密碼嗎?能夠!可是這樣會讓你的數據庫密碼暴露出來,因此建議你們之後先回車,再輸入密碼,mysql會爲你隱藏密碼。

  

  8.登陸時若是出現如圖所示的狀況:

  在輸入密碼的時候輸入初始密碼:

 

 

  9.登陸成功後,在操做數據庫的時候會報如下錯誤:

 1 ERROR 1820 (HY000): You must reset your password using ALTER USER statement before executing this statement. 

  這是由於此時你的密碼時初始密碼,你須要先修改密碼才能夠繼續操做。

  修改密碼以下:

 1 alter user 'root'@'localhost' identified by '123456'; 

  最後的「123456」替換爲你想要設置的密碼,切記不要設置爲純數字或者純密碼,密碼太簡單也會報錯。

  修改完以後,提示OK,說明修改爲功!

  ctrl+z退出mysql,從新使用新密碼登陸便可。

PS:若是當登陸時出現沒法登陸的狀況或者忘記root密碼(請先檢查mysql服務是否已開啓),請看一下文章

https://www.cnblogs.com/honeynan/p/12408144.html

 

navicat數據庫可視化工具:免註冊版。(注意不須要註冊碼,不能進行商用)

連接:https://www.cnblogs.com/honeynan/p/12061799.html

相關文章
相關標籤/搜索